Our mission is to bring community and belonging to everyone in the world. Reddit is a community of communities where people can dive into anything through experiences built around their interests, hobbies, and passions. With more than 50 million people visiting 100,000+ communities daily, it is home to the most open and authentic conversations on the internet. From pets to parenting, skincare to stocks, there’s a community for everybody on Reddit. For more information, visit redditinc.com

As a member of the Consumer Products ML team,  you’ll work with the billions of events and terabytes of data generated every day to personalize Reddit for each of our over 50 million daily users, helping them to connect with their communities and discover the best of Reddit.

 

How You'll Have Impact

You will own projects from ideation to production instead of being stuck making small incremental gains on enterprise systems. You’ll work with a super talented, cross-functional team to solve hard problems in order to create experiences that users will love. We are a team of builders that value impact, personal growth, openness and kindness.

What You’ll Do

  • Lead projects where you’ll apply Machine Learning to personalization, discovery and recommendation problems.
  • Build and deploy sophisticated machine learning models to improve experiences for millions of users.
  • Participate in the full software development cycle: design, develop, QA, deploy, experiment, analyze and iterate.
  • Collaborate across disciplines and with other ML teams at Reddit to find technical solutions to complex challenges.

 

Who you might be

  • 5+ years of work experience in Machine Learning in a production-based environment.
  • Solid theoretical knowledge of Machine Learning and Statistical concepts, including Deep Learning, as well as performance tradeoffs. Experience with recommender and/or ranking systems is a plus.
  • Experience  with at least 2 of: Tensorflow, Keras, PyTorch and Sklearn
  • Experience working with data-intensive systems and writing production-quality software (preferred Python or golang)
  • The ability to extract insight from data; proficient with SQL
  • Passionate about building delightful products for users
  • Strong communication and team-work skills
